@charset "utf-8";
body {
	padding: 0px;
	float: none;
	width: 1024px;
	background-image: url(images/websmart_08.jpg);
	background-repeat: repeat;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in-top: 0px;
	margin-right: auto;
	margin-bottom: 0px;
	margin-left: auto;
}
.header {
	background-image: url(images/websmart1_02.jpg);
	height: auto;
	width: 1026px;
	background-position: left bottom;
	float: left;
	background-repeat: no-repeat;
}
.header .logo {
	background-image: url(../images/websmart2_02.jpg);
	float: left;
	height: 166px;
	width: 219px;
	margin-bottom: 53px;
	margin-left: 2px;
}
.header .header_content {
	float: left;
	height: auto;
	width: 293px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	vertical-align: bottom;
	text-align: center;
	margin: 0px;
	background-position: bottom;
	padding-top: 30px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
}
.header .logo2 {
	background-image: url(images/websmart1_03.jpg);
	height: 215px;
	width: 250px;
	float: left;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 523px;
	background-position: left bottom;
}
.master .form_holder {
	float: left;
	height: auto;
	width: 210px;
}
.master {
	float: left;
	height: auto;
	width: 1024px;
	background-color: #FFFFFF;
}
.master .left_nav {
	float: left;
	height: auto;
	width: 205px;
}
.master .content {
	float: left;
	height: auto;
	width: 580px;
	padding-left: 20px;
	padding-right: 10px;
}
.master .left_nav .left_nav_pill {
	float: left;
	height: auto;
	width: 194px;
	padding-top: 20px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 5px;
}
.master .left_nav .left_nav_pill .left_nav_header {
	float: left;
	height: 36px;
	width: 194px;
	background-image: url(images/websmart_25.jpg);
}
.master .left_nav .left_nav_pill .left_nav_filler {
	float: left;
	height: auto;
	width: 183px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 5px;
	border-top-width: thin;
	border-right-width: thin;
	border-bottom-width: thin;
	border-left-width: thin;
	border-top-style: none;
	border-right-style: solid;
	border-bottom-style: solid;
	border-left-style: solid;
	border-top-color: #cc0000;
	border-right-color: #cc0000;
	border-bottom-color: #cc0000;
	border-left-color: #cc0000;
	background-color: #fbedcb;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 10px;
	padding-left: 0px;
}
.master .form_holder .top_nav {
	float: left;
	height: auto;
	width: 185px;
}
.master .form_holder .bottem1_nav {
	float: left;
	height: auto;
	width: 200px;
}
.master .form_holder .bottem2_nav {
	float: left;
	height: auto;
	width: 200px;
}
.master .form_holder .top_nav .top_nav_top {
	background-image: url(images/websmart_12.jpg);
	float: left;
	height: 17px;
	width: 176px;
	margin: 0px;
	padding: 0px;
}
.master .form_holder .top_nav .top_nav_filler {
	background-image: url(images/websmart3_15.jpg);
	background-repeat: repeat-y;
	padding: 0px;
	float: left;
	height: auto;
	width: 179px;
	margin: 0px;
}
.master .form_holder .top_nav .top_nav_footer {
	background-image: url(images/websmart3_23.jpg);
	margin: 0px;
	padding: 0px;
	float: left;
	height: 10px;
	width: 178px;
}
.master .form_holder .bottem1_nav .bottem1_nav_top {
	background-image: url(images/websmart3_25.jpg);
	margin: 0px;
	padding: 0px;
	float: left;
	height: 16px;
	width: 176px;
}
.master .form_holder .bottem1_nav .bottem1_nav_filler {
	background-image: url(images/websmart3_27.jpg);
	background-repeat: repeat-y;
	margin: 0px;
	float: left;
	height: auto;
	width: 178px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}
.master .form_holder .bottem1_nav .bottem1_nav_footer {
	background-image: url(images/websmart3_29.jpg);
	margin: 0px;
	padding: 0px;
	float: left;
	height: 11px;
	width: 178px;
}
.master .form_holder .bottem2_nav .bottem2_nav_top {
	background-image: url(images/websmart3_31.jpg);
	margin: 0px;
	padding: 0px;
	float: left;
	height: 16px;
	width: 178px;
}
.master .form_holder .bottem2_nav .bottem2_nav_filler {
	background-image: url(images/websmart3_33.jpg);
	background-repeat: repeat-y;
	margin: 0px;
	float: left;
	height: auto;
	width: 178px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 10px;
}
.master .form_holder .bottem2_nav .bottem2_nav_footer {
	background-image: url(images/websmart3_34.jpg);
	margin: 0px;
	padding: 0px;
	float: left;
	height: 13px;
	width: 178px;
}
.header .header_content2 {
	float: left;
	height: auto;
	width: 293px;
	padding: 0px;
	margin-top: 30px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
}
.header .header_content .style2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 18px;
	text-align: left;
}
.header .header_menu {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	float: left;
	height: 215px;
	width: 250px;
	margin: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 0px;
	color: #FFFFFF;
	text-align: center;
	font-size: 12px;
	background-image: url(images/websmart1_04.jpg);
	background-position: left bottom;
	background-repeat: no-repeat;
	line-height: 10px;
}
.style1 {
	color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-align: left;
}
.style2 {
	color: #edb157;
	font-size: 24px;
}
li {
	list-style-image: url(images/websmart3_20.jpg);
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 10px;
}
h3 {
	background-image: url(images/websmart3_03.jpg);
	background-repeat: no-repeat;
	height: 30px;
	padding-top: 0px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 30px;
	line-height: 200%;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#707ab6;
	font-size: 12px;
	border-bottom-width: thin;
	border-bottom-style: dotted;
	border-bottom-color: #ff3333;
	margin-top: 0px;
	margin-right: 10px;
	margin-bottom: 0px;
	margin-left: 0px;
}
.master .left_nav ul {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	margin: 0px;
	height: auto;
	width: auto;
	padding-top: 20px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 20px;
}
.master .form_holder .top_nav .top_nav_filler table {
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	width: 160px;
	padding: 0px;
	float: left;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 10px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
.master .content h1 {
	font-size: 24px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	margin-left: 0px;
	border-bottom-width: thin;
	border-bottom-style: solid;
	border-bottom-color: #000000;
	margin-right: 40px;
}
.master .content h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#283891;
	font-size: 14px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}
.footer {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	text-align: center;
	float: left;
	height: auto;
	width: 1024px;
	margin-left: 75px;
	color: #999999;
	margin-bottom: 5px;
}
.footer a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
	color: #999999;
}
.header .header_menu a {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	text-decoration: none;
}
.master .content ul {
	list-style-image: url(images/websmart4_03.jpg);
}
.master .left_nav .left_nav_pill .left_nav_filler h4 {
	padding: 0px;
	border-bottom-width: thin;
	border-bottom-style: dotted;
	border-bottom-color: #ff3333;
	margin-top: 0px;
	margin-right: 50px;
	margin-bottom: 0px;
	margin-left: 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#283891;
}
.master .form_holder .top_nav .top_nav_filler #form4 .button {
	background-image: url(images/websmart_18.jpg);
	background-repeat: no-repeat;
	height: 37px;
	width: 157px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}
.master .content table {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
}
.form .formhead {
	background-image: url(http://jcagency.com/clients/project_steve/scooltunescom/scooltunes_images/images/form_01.jpg);
	float: left;
	height: 20px;
	width: 182px;
}
.form .formbod {
	background-image: url(http://jcagency.com/clients/project_steve/scooltunescom/scooltunes_images/images/form_03.jpg);
	background-repeat: repeat-y;
	width: 162px;
	float: left;
	padding-right: 10px;
	padding-left: 10px;
	font-size: 10px;
}
.form .formfoot {
	background-image: url(http://jcagency.com/clients/project_steve/scooltunescom/scooltunes_images/images/form_05.jpg);
	float: left;
	height: 18px;
	width: 182px;
}
.form {
	float: left;
	width: 182px;
	margin-left: 10px;
}
.form #icpsignup .formbod .submit {
	background-image: url(http://jcagency.com/clients/project_steve/scooltunescom/scooltunes_images/images/scooltunes.jpg);
	padding: 0px;
	height: 35px;
	width: 157px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	font-size: 1px;
	color: #C90C12;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 10px;
	margin-left: 0px;
}
.formbod .textinsert {
	padding: 0px;
	margin-top: 5px;
	margin-right: 5px;
	margin-bottom: 20px;
	margin-left: 5px;
}
.formbod h1 {
	font-size: 12px;
	margin: 0px;
	padding: 0px;
}
